Akira Itô
About
Akira Itô has authored 529 papers that have received a total of 16.8k indexed citations.
This includes 198 papers in Molecular Biology, 84 papers in Biomedical Engineering and 55 papers in Immunology. The topics of these papers are Protease and Inhibitor Mechanisms (34 papers), 3D Printing in Biomedical Research (33 papers) and Tissue Engineering and Regenerative Medicine (24 papers). Akira Itô is often cited by papers focused on Protease and Inhibitor Mechanisms (34 papers), 3D Printing in Biomedical Research (33 papers) and Tissue Engineering and Regenerative Medicine (24 papers) and collaborates with scholars based in Japan, United States and United Kingdom. Akira Itô's co-authors include Hiroyuki Honda, Takashi Sato, Takeshi Kobayashi, Yo Mori and Masamichi Kamihira and has published in prestigious journals such as Science, New England Journal of Medicine and Proceedings of the National Academy of Sciences.
